Answer: Amoeba proteus is a microscopic organism with a large cell. It's available at most science supply companies that sell living organisms and is often used by schools. In nature, it lives in bodies of fresh water, such as ponds. It feeds on smaller one-celled creatures, algae, and rotifers.
